Lenten Mini Retreats

Lent is a time for us to pause and to make extra time for prayer, penance and reflection. To assist us on this journey, we are offering mini-retreats on 3 consecutive Saturdays during Lent: March 4, 11 & 18. Our priest-presenters will offer the 8:00 am Mass and then begin the talks approximately 15 minutes after Mass/prayers/devotions have ended. A Lenten snack will be available in the Parish Life Center during this break time. In our second presentation, on March 11th, Fr. Cameron Faller, of the San Francisco Archdiocese spoke on the “Four Last Things”: death, judgment, heaven and hell. This coming Saturday, March 18th, will be our final presentation with Fr. Raul Lemus, of St. Joseph Church in Cotati. Fr. Lemus will talk about “holiness” and base his presentation on a homily given by St. John Chrysostom (347-407 AD) with the theme being: Holiness cannot exist without evangelization.”
